XPH Client Details - Hide Unnecessary fields when creating record.
Ability to remove unnecessary fields when setting up a client in XPM or ability to hide the blank fields after the setup so that they don't show up in the Client Details Tab. The purpose is to see the fields with details on them only and to make them look neat and tidy. Please see attached.

The edit client details tab in XPH doesn't seem logically set out and asks for non-relevant information. For example, even if you select a 'sole trader' or 'individual' for the business structure, it still displays a box to enter a company number and then at the bottom of the page a whole section on 'Company Info and Company Tax'? Would it not be be better for the business structure question to then determine the information that's required rather than it always being present? Similarly, if the client is not VAT registered or doesn't have a Payroll scheme, don't ask for VAT numbers, PAYE references etc.
